In 1986 the federal government gave a grant to Chinle USD to build a new Chinle HS building, with the grant totaling $10,000,000. The Chinle Wildcats are used to what they call "rezball," a more intense version of basketball popular among Native American communities. A previous facility, with capacity for about 300 students, was constructed prior to 1966.
